Popular community pub, the Turf Family Pub on Grove Street in Telford, reopened on Saturday 11th April following a transformational combined investment of £200,000 from experienced licensee, Steve Wright and Admiral Taverns, the UK’s leading community pub company.
This refurbishment has breathed a new lease of life into the Turf Family Pub to elevate and modernise the overall look and feel – whilst still retaining the original charm and characterful features of the building which has stood on the site for almost a century – ultimately enabling the licensee to further cement it as the go-to community hub for local residents.
Internally, the pub has been undergone a complete transformation to include brand new flooring, a fresh coat of paint and a newly developed lounge area which has elevated the Turf Family Pub’s atmosphere and expanded its offering to ensure it caters to all tastes.
Externally, the Turf Family Pub has been revamped to include brand new signage as well as a fresh coat of exterior paint to greet visitors. In addition to this, the pub’s beer garden and kids play area have been refreshed, ensuring that adults and children alike can enjoy the sunshine in the months ahead.
Passionate licensee, Steve Wright brings a wealth of knowledge and expertise to the pub having spent the past three decades working in the pub trade, having worked in pubs both in the UK and Tenerife. Originally from Stoke, he relocated to Telford with his wife Julie, who is local to the area, six years ago, taking over the Turf Family Pub. As the licensee, Steve leads the general running of the pub, with Julie providing essential support by heading up the kitchen operations. Going forward, they are committed to creating a family friendly community pub that brings people together and supports all aspects of community life.

To mark the reopening, the Turf Family Pub hosted a day full of celebrations on Saturday 11th of April, with food and entertainment throughout the day and into the night. The pub was officially opened by Tracie Harrison, Director of Income Generation from Severn Hospice, a charity which is close to the hearts of both the pub and the wider community. In her speech she thanked the licensee and pub team for their continued support and fundraising efforts, wishing them well on their reopening.
Going forward, the pub will be hosting a busy schedule of regular entertainment for the community to enjoy including weekly karaoke, live music and bingo. In addition, as part of its mission to give back to the local community, it will continue to host regular fundraising events/community initiatives such as the annual golf day in aid of Severn Hospice.
